Computer, video game stolen in break-in

By Jim Patten
Staff Writer

HAVERHILL — A break into a Lake Street home netted thieves a laptop computer, a video game console and the Guitar Hero 3 video game, police said.

The homeowner told police he was out Thursday, dropping off his son about 2 p.m., and found the break-in when he returned about 4:30 p.m.

When he noticed the back door was unlocked he checked the house and noticed an Apple laptop computer valued at $1,600, an XBox 360 video game console valued at $400 and the Guitar Hero 3 video game valued at $80 were missing.

The victim told police he found his son's bedroom window open, and it appeared that someone had forced the window screen up and opened the window. He told police he was not sure if the window had been locked.
